The forecasted data indicates stability in the laparoscopic repair of inguinal hernia procedures per 100 persons in Germany from 2024 to 2025, with no change at 360.0 procedures. An increase is projected from 2026 onwards, with values reaching 370.0 and eventually 380.0 by 2028. This translates to a consistent year-on-year increase of around 2.8% beginning in 2026. The compound annual growth rate (CAGR) from 2024 to 2028 is approximately 1.4%.
Future trends to watch include advancements in minimally invasive surgical techniques and their adoption rates. Additionally, demographic shifts, particularly the aging population, may influence future demand for these procedures.
